Output e1358f89990b783439b6bc02b51f12c2085e133083cf8c2a3579b3092a87f98a:0

value
37995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000d23a56b0d4a42d1b46847514041356880218e OP_EQUAL
address
31hHfUTy87p2qgbnWdDCXoYto159UHywtZ
transaction
e1358f89990b783439b6bc02b51f12c2085e133083cf8c2a3579b3092a87f98a
confirmations
228679
spent
true